Partâ… : The expression of vascular endothelial growth factor gene transferred bone marrow stromal stem cells.Objective To study the expression of VEGF gene transferred BMSCs.Methods BMSCs were obtained from SD rat, the cultured BMSCs were transferred with the composite of pcDNA3.1-VEGF165 and Lipofecfamine regant in the ratio of 1/3 in vitro. The transcription and transient and stable expression of VEGF gene were investigate by using RT-PCR assay and immuno-histochemistry S-P method respectively. VEGF protein in culture medium were measured by enzyme linked immunosorbent assay(ELISA) method. The cell proliferation was detected by MTT method. Compared with the pcDNA3.1- transferred group and un-transferred group.Results the cell proliferation of the transferred BMSCs were similar to those of the control group. The transcription and expression of VEGF gene were found distinctly in gene transferred BMSCs after 48h of transfection and 4 weeks of culture. The control group were not found the transcription and expression.VEGF expression of the transferred BMSCs increased in 1 week,after that, the expression of VEGF gradually decreased.Conclusions 1. transferred by VEGF gene, the BMSCs can transcript and express the VEGF protein, ability of expression increased in 1 week, after that, the expression...
